Checking the Power Remaining in the NiCad Battery Pack<br />

You can use the POWER.EXE utility to check the power remaining in the<br />

reader’s NiCad battery pack. To display the current power status, type this<br />

command at the DOS prompt and press :<br />

power<br />

Or scan this bar code:<br />

*POWER*<br />

*POWER*<br />

The Power Management Status screen appears similar to this example:<br />

Power Management Status<br />

-----------------------<br />

Setting = ADV: MIN<br />

CPU: idle 36% of time<br />

AC Line Status : OFFLINE<br />

Battery Status : High<br />

Battery life (%) :<br />

80<br />
